SinuTrain is Siemens’ PC-based offline programming and simulation software that replicates the user interface and behavior of the SINUMERIK CNC control family. For SINUMERIK Operate 4.8 (Edition 2), SinuTrain provides a faithful virtual environment for creating, testing, and validating NC programs before deploying them to the machine, reducing setup time and minimizing machining errors.
SinuTrain is the official PC-based programming and simulation software from Siemens for the SINUMERIK CNC family. Version 4.8, Edition 2 corresponds to the SINUMERIK Operate 4.8 user interface, which is the HMI (Human-Machine Interface) software generation used on many SINUMERIK 828D, 840D sl, and One controllers. Edition 2 (Ed.2) indicates a minor update or service pack within the 4.8 release branch, including bug fixes and stability improvements over the initial 4.8 release.

SinuTrain for SINUMERIK Operate 4.8 Ed.2 is a PC-based CNC programming and training software that mirrors the actual SINUMERIK 840D sl and 828D control systems. It is widely used for offline program verification, production planning, and vocational training. Key Features
Control-Identical Software: Uses the original SINUMERIK CNC kernel, ensuring that operations and programming on the PC are identical to the actual machine.

Realistic Simulation: Features an animated machine control panel and 3D simulation for almost 100% offline verification of NC programs.
Improved Interface: Version 4.8 introduces a tile-based display for managing machines with drag-and-drop, expanded 16:9 resolution support, and a more intuitive workbench.
